A waiver for minors is a binding legal agreement, signed by a parent or guardian. It grants permission for a child to engage in an activity while absolving the provider of specific liabilities. Since minors cant legally sign contracts, these waivers are vital.
WHAT ARE WAIVERS AND RELEASES? Waivers and/or releases of liability (releases) are legal agreements designed to transfer responsibility for injuries and property damage from one party to another.
An exception excludes specific cases from a rule, while a waiver represents the voluntary choice to give up a right. The reason for an exception is often practical, allowing for fairness in specific situations, while waivers are usually based on individual agreements between parties.
